İngilizceFransızcaİspanyolca

Ad


OnWorks favicon'u

db2x_xsltproc - Bulutta Çevrimiçi

Ubuntu Online, Fedora Online, Windows çevrimiçi öykünücüsü veya MAC OS çevrimiçi öykünücüsü üzerinden OnWorks ücretsiz barındırma sağlayıcısında db2x_xsltproc çalıştırın

Bu, Ubuntu Online, Fedora Online, Windows çevrimiçi öykünücüsü veya MAC OS çevrimiçi öykünücüsü gibi birden çok ücretsiz çevrimiçi iş istasyonumuzdan biri kullanılarak OnWorks ücretsiz barındırma sağlayıcısında çalıştırılabilen db2x_xsltproc komutudur.

Program:

ADI


db2x_xsltproc - XSLT işlemci çağırma sarmalayıcısı

SİNOPSİS


db2x_xsltproc [seçenekleri] xml-belgesi

TANIM


db2x_xsltproc docbook1.0X için XSLT 2 işlemcisini çağırır.

Bu komut, XSLT stil sayfasını uygular (genellikle --stil sayfası seçeneği)
Dosyadaki XML belgesi xml-belgesi. Sonuç standart çıktıya yazılır (eğer
ile değişti --çıktı).

Kaynak XML belgesini standart girdiden okumak için girdi belgesi olarak - belirtin.

SEÇENEKLER


--versiyon
docbook2X sürümünü görüntüleyin.

DÖNÜŞÜM ÇIKTI SEÇENEKLER
--çıktı dosya, -o dosya
Standart çıktı yerine çıktıyı verilen dosyaya (veya URI'ye) yazın.

KAYNAK BELGE SEÇENEKLER
--xinclude, -I
Process XInclude direktiflerini kaynak belgeye ekleyin.

--sgml, -S
Giriş belgesinin XML yerine SGML olduğunu belirtin. Bu sete ihtiyacın var
seçenek ise xml-belgesi aslında bir SGML dosyasıdır.

SGML ayrıştırması, XML'e dönüştürülerek uygulanır. sgml2xml(1) SP'den
paket (veya osx(1) OpenSP paketinden). SGML dosyasındaki tüm etiket adları
küçük harfe normalleştirilmiş (yani -xdaha düşük seçeneği sgml2xml(1) kullanılır). İD
stil sayfası için nitelikler mevcuttur (yani seçenek -xid). Ayrıca, herhangi bir
SGML belgesinde kullanılan ISO SDATA varlıkları, otomatik olarak
XML Unicode eşdeğerleri. (Bu, bir susuzluk filtre.)

SGML belgesinin kodlaması us-ascii değilse ile belirtilmelidir.
standart SP ortam değişkenleri: SP_CHARSET_FIXED=1 SP_ENCODING=kodlama.
(XML dosyalarının, kodlamalarını XML bildirimi ile belirttiğini unutmayın. <?xml
sürüm = "1.0" kodlama="kodlama" ?> Dosyanın en üstünde.)

Yukarıdaki dönüştürme seçenekleri değiştirilemez. Farklı bir dönüşüm istiyorsanız
seçenekleri, çağırmanız gerekir sgml2xml(1) manuel olarak ve ardından bunun sonuçlarını iletin
bu programa dönüştürün.

ALIM SEÇENEKLER
--kataloglar katalog dosyaları, -C katalog dosyaları
Resmi Genel Tanımlayıcıları çözmek için kullanılacak ek XML kataloglarını belirtin veya
URI'ler. SGML katalogları desteklenmez.

Bu kataloglar değil altında bir SGML belgesini ayrıştırmak için kullanılır. --sgml seçeneği.
Ortam değişkenini kullanın SGML_CATALOG_FILES bunun yerine katalogları belirtmek için
SGML belgesini ayrıştırma.

--ağ, -N
db2x_xsltproc normalde ağdan harici kaynakları yüklemeyi reddeder, çünkü
güvenlik nedenleri. Ağdan yüklemek istiyorsanız bu seçeneği ayarlayın.

Genellikle ilgili DTD'leri ve diğer dosyaları yerel olarak yüklemek istersiniz ve
ağdan otomatik olarak yüklemek yerine onlar için kataloglar oluşturun.

stil sayfası SEÇENEKLER
--stil sayfası dosya, -s dosya
Kullanılacak stil sayfasının dosya adını (veya URI'sini) belirtin. Özel değerler insan ve
texi kısaltmalar olarak kabul edilir, bunu belirtmek için xml-belgesi DocBook'ta ve
man sayfalarına veya Texinfo'ya (sırasıyla) dönüştürülmelidir.

--param isim=İfade, -p isim=İfade
Stil sayfasına bir parametre ekleyin veya değiştirin. isim bir XSLT parametre adıdır ve
İfade parametre için istenen değeri değerlendiren bir XPath ifadesidir.
(Bu, dizelerin alıntılanması gerektiği anlamına gelir, in ilave Shell'in olağan alıntısına
argümanlar; kullanmak --string-param bundan kaçınmak için.)

--string-param isim=dizi, -g isim=dizi
Stil sayfasına dize değerli bir parametre ekleyin veya değiştirin.

Dize UTF-8'de kodlanmalıdır (yerel ayar karakter kodlamasından bağımsız olarak).

HATA AYIKLAMA VE PROFİL
- hata ayıklama, -d
XSL sırasında neler olup bittiğine ilişkin günlükleri standart hataya göre görüntüleyin
dönüşümü.

--iç içe geçme sınırı n, -D n
Algılamak için kullanılan maksimum iç içe çağrı sayısını XSL şablonlarına değiştirin.
potansiyel sonsuz döngüler. Belirtilmezse, sınır 500'dür (libxslt'nin varsayılanı).

--profil, -P
Profil bilgilerini görüntüle: şablondaki her bir şablona yapılan toplam çağrı sayısı.
stil sayfası ve her biri için geçen süre. Bu bilgi standart çıktıdır
hata.

--xslt-işlemci işlemci, -X işlemci
Kullanılan temel XSLT işlemcisini seçin. için olası seçenekler işlemci şunlardır:
libxslt, sakson, xalan-j.

Varsayılan işlemci, docbook2X oluşturulduğunda ayarlanan şeydir. libxslt
önerilir (çünkü yalın ve hızlıdır), ancak SAXON çok daha sağlamdır ve
stil sayfalarında hata ayıklarken daha yararlı olun.

Tüm işlemcilerde XML katalog desteği etkindir. (docbook2X bunu gerektirir.)
Ancak yukarıdaki tüm seçeneklerin libxslt dışındaki işlemcilerle çalışmadığını unutmayın.
bir.

ÇEVRE


XML_CATALOG_FILES
XML Kataloglarını belirtin. Belirtilmemişse, standart katalog (/etc/xml/katalog) 'dir
varsa yüklenir.

DB2X_XSLT_İŞLEMCİ
Kullanılacak XSLT işlemciyi belirtin. Etkisi ile aynıdır --xslt-işlemci
seçenek. Bu değişkenin birincil kullanımı, farklı değişkenleri hızlı bir şekilde test etmenize izin vermektir.
Eklemek zorunda kalmadan XSLT işlemciler --xslt-işlemci her komut dosyasına veya dosyaya
dokümantasyon oluşturma sisteminizde.

UYGUN TO


XML Stil Sayfası Dili – Dönüşümler (XSLT), sürüm 1.0 ⟨http://www.w3.org/TR/xslt
, bir W3C Tavsiyesi.

NOTLAR


Önceki sürümlerinde (< 0.8.4), docbook2X'in çalışması için XSLT uzantıları gerekiyordu ve
db2x_xsltproc bu uzantıların derlenmiş olduğu özel bir libxslt tabanlı işlemciydi.
XSLT uzantıları gereksinimi kaldırıldığında, db2x_xsltproc Perl betiği oldu
hangi seçenekleri çevirir db2x_xsltproc tarafından kabul edilen formata uymak için
Stok xsltproc(1) libxslt ile birlikte gelir.

Bu betiğin varlığının ana nedeni, herhangi bir programla geriye dönük uyumluluktur.
docbook2X'i çağıran komut dosyaları veya dosyalar oluşturun. Ancak, eklemek de kolaylaştı
birleşik bir komut satırı arabirimiyle diğer XSLT işlemcilerini çağırma desteği. Aslında,
bu komut dosyasında docbook2X ve hatta DocBook için özel bir şey yoktur ve
dilerseniz diğer stil sayfalarını çalıştırmak için kullanılır. Kesinlikle yazar tercih ediyor
çağırma biçimi aklı başında ve kullanımı kolay olduğundan, bu komutu kullanarak. (örn. hayır
Java tabanlı işlemciler için uzun sınıf adları yazarak!)

onworks.net hizmetlerini kullanarak db2x_xsltproc'u çevrimiçi kullanın


Ücretsiz Sunucular ve İş İstasyonları

Windows ve Linux uygulamalarını indirin

Linux komutları

Ad